diff --git a/src/salloc/Makefile.am b/src/salloc/Makefile.am
index 3f795540da860d18519dd4555367e2ca08496c20..10faf04a0736e6b4f2084bddaf8201304cc5c63d 100644
--- a/src/salloc/Makefile.am
+++ b/src/salloc/Makefile.am
@@ -14,9 +14,11 @@ convenience_libs = $(top_builddir)/src/api/libslurm.o $(DL_LIBS)
 salloc_LDADD = \
 	$(convenience_libs)
 
+if HAVE_ALPS_CRAY
 if HAVE_REAL_CRAY
   salloc_LDADD += -ljob
 endif
+endif
 
 salloc_LDFLAGS = -export-dynamic $(CMD_LDFLAGS) \
 	$(HWLOC_LDFLAGS) $(HWLOC_LIBS)
diff --git a/src/salloc/Makefile.in b/src/salloc/Makefile.in
index dd01cf9e9d3fa314ba09f4cd687587acdb00ffd4..26f9666ea9511751ba6b8e6007543d5a2ec93c6e 100644
--- a/src/salloc/Makefile.in
+++ b/src/salloc/Makefile.in
@@ -55,7 +55,7 @@ build_triplet = @build@
 host_triplet = @host@
 target_triplet = @target@
 bin_PROGRAMS = salloc$(EXEEXT)
-@HAVE_REAL_CRAY_TRUE@am__append_1 = -ljob
+@HAVE_ALPS_CRAY_TRUE@@HAVE_REAL_CRAY_TRUE@am__append_1 = -ljob
 subdir = src/salloc
 DIST_COMMON = $(srcdir)/Makefile.am $(srcdir)/Makefile.in
 ACLOCAL_M4 = $(top_srcdir)/aclocal.m4